About This Center

Located in Glen Burnie, MD, Seven 2 Seven Medical Services LLC offers an extensive array of outpatient treatment programs designed for both adults and seniors. This facility specializes in detoxification, treatment for substance use disorders, and addressing co-occurring mental health issues. Among the services provided are outpatient detox, as well as methadone and buprenorphine treatment. The facility employs evidence-based methodologies, including cognitive behavioral therapy and motivational incentives, to enhance the effectiveness of their programs. For those in unique circumstances, such as active duty military personnel, adolescents, and adult men, Seven 2 Seven Medical Services LLC delivers specialized and tailored care, ensuring each client receives the support they need. Catering to both men and women, this center is dedicated to providing high-quality care and assistance for individuals on their journey to overcome addiction and improve their mental health.
